متن کاملEnhanced Thermoelectric Figure of Merit in Edge Disordered Zigzag Graphene Nanoribbons
We investigate electron and phonon transport through edge disordered zigzag graphene nanoribbons based on the same methodological tool of nonequilibrium Green functions. We show that edge disorder dramatically reduces phonon thermal transport while being only weakly detrimental to electronic conduction.
